.tv-menu[data-v-2c00a80f]{min-height:100vh;background:linear-gradient(160deg,var(--tv-bg-from),var(--tv-bg-to));color:var(--tv-text);font-family:var(--tv-font-body)}.tv-menu-inner[data-v-2c00a80f]{padding:clamp(1rem,2vw,2.5rem);position:relative}.tv-image-only[data-v-2c00a80f],.tv-menu-inner[data-v-2c00a80f]{min-height:100vh;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.tv-image-only[data-v-2c00a80f]{background:#050505;overflow:hidden}.tv-generated-board[data-v-2c00a80f]{width:100vw;height:100vh;-o-object-fit:contain;object-fit:contain;display:block}.tv-pattern-dots[data-v-2c00a80f]:before{content:"";position:fixed;inset:0;pointer-events:none;opacity:.07;background-image:radial-gradient(var(--tv-text) 1px,transparent 0);background-size:22px 22px}.tv-pattern-mesh[data-v-2c00a80f]:before{content:"";position:fixed;inset:0;pointer-events:none;opacity:.35;background:radial-gradient(ellipse 80% 50% at 20% 10%,rgba(201,162,39,.18),transparent 55%),radial-gradient(ellipse 60% 40% at 90% 80%,rgba(201,162,39,.12),transparent 50%)}.tv-meta[data-v-2c00a80f]{position:fixed;top:1rem;right:1rem;z-index:2;color:var(--tv-muted)!important;letter-spacing:.14em}.tv-columns[data-v-2c00a80f]{width:min(92vw,1500px);-webkit-column-width:380px;-moz-column-width:380px;column-width:380px;-webkit-column-gap:clamp(1.5rem,3vw,3rem);-moz-column-gap:clamp(1.5rem,3vw,3rem);column-gap:clamp(1.5rem,3vw,3rem)}.tv-columns-single[data-v-2c00a80f]{-webkit-column-width:auto;-moz-column-width:auto;column-width:auto;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.tv-category[data-v-2c00a80f]{-webkit-column-break-inside:avoid;-moz-column-break-inside:avoid;break-inside:avoid;margin:0 auto 2rem;padding:clamp(1.2rem,2.6vw,2.4rem);border-radius:var(--tv-radius);background:var(--tv-panel);border:1px solid hsla(0,0%,100%,.1)}.tv-columns-single .tv-category[data-v-2c00a80f]{width:min(980px,100%)}.tv-cat-title[data-v-2c00a80f]{font-family:var(--tv-font-display);font-size:clamp(2rem,4vw,3.25rem);font-weight:700;border-bottom:3px solid rgba(201,162,39,.55);padding-bottom:.65rem;margin-bottom:1rem;color:var(--tv-text);text-align:center}.tv-item[data-v-2c00a80f]{font-size:clamp(1.25rem,2.2vw,1.85rem);padding:.5rem 0;border-bottom:1px dashed hsla(0,0%,100%,.12);color:var(--tv-text)}.tv-item-price[data-v-2c00a80f]{font-weight:700;letter-spacing:.02em;color:var(--tv-accent)}